Current status of clinical background of patients with atrial fibrillation in a community-based survey: The Fushimi AF Registry

Abstract: The Fushimi AF Registry provides a unique snapshot of current AF management in an urban community in Japan.

“…In the era of warfarin, OAC was overused for low-risk patients, and also underused for high-risk patients. 9 After the release of DOAC, the total prevalence of OAC increased gradually, but use of OAC increased predominantly in low-risk patients. This suggests that the 23 Use of under-dose DOAC is common in real-world clinical practice, and although it may have a more favorable bleeding profile, it may also result in insufficient stroke prevention.…”
